Orange County Real Estate: Navigating a Competitive Market in April 2024

The Orange County real estate market has been demonstrating significant resilience and competitiveness in the last few months. With a diverse range of properties spanning from coastal cities to suburban neighborhoods, Orange County remains a highly sought-after destination for both residents and investors. Here's a comprehensive overview of the latest trends and data that are shaping the market as of April 2024.


Market Overview

  • Rising Home Prices: The median home prices in Orange County have continued to rise, with properties selling for a median price of $1.1M, up by 15.8% compared to last year​ (Redfin)​. This upward trend is reflective of the high demand and limited inventory within the county, placing sellers in a favorable position.

  • Sales Activity: The sales volume has shown robust performance, with a notable increase in existing, single-family home sales. This February, sales in California saw a 12.8 percent surge from January, with Orange County experiencing a significant month-to-month increase of 23.6 percent in sales activity​ (Norada Real Estate Investments)​.

  • Days on Market: Properties are selling faster, with homes in Orange County spending an average of 52 days on the market, down from 54 days the previous week. The median days on the market stand at 24 days, indicating a rapid turnover rate which underscores the competitive nature of the market​ (Ocrealestateinc.com)​.

  • Market Composition: The market comprises a mix of single-family homes and condos, with single-family homes selling slightly above their list price on average, indicating that sellers have more bargaining power in pricing. Condos, on the other hand, sell around their list price, suggesting a market in equilibrium​ (ZeroDown)​.

Future Outlook

The Orange County real estate market is currently leaning towards being a seller's market, driven by high demand and limited inventory. Despite challenges such as potential rises in mortgage interest rates, the market shows resilience and adaptability. The expectation for the rest of the year is cautiously optimistic, with ongoing demand likely to keep prices stable or even push them higher, although economic conditions, interest rates, and housing supply will play crucial roles in determining market dynamics​ (Norada Real Estate Investments)​.

Advice for Buyers and Sellers

  • For Buyers: With the market being highly competitive, acting swiftly and being financially prepared are crucial. Opportunities still exist, especially for those looking at properties listed for over 90 days, which may offer less competition​ (Ocrealestateinc.com)​.

  • For Sellers: The current market dynamics favor sellers, with many properties selling above the asking price. Sellers should leverage the competitive market to maximize their returns, considering the high demand and the rapid pace at which properties are moving​ (Ocrealestateinc.com)​.
